XML書籍
HOME  >  XML書籍  >  XMLデータベース入門以前

XMLデータベース入門以前

本書の特徴

本書は、XMLの基礎知識をはじめ、RDBとの違い、適応分野など、XMLデータベースを初心者向けに解説した本です。

基礎知識では、HTMLとXMLの違いやメタデータといった基本的な部分から、DTD、XML Schema、XQuery、XPathといったXML仕様を、RDBとの比較では、データ構造、スキーマ、データの順序性など、より踏み込んで解説しています。

付録には、ネイティブXMLデータベースである「NeoCoreXMS」の体験版がついており、それを使って、実際にDBを構築して体験できる章も設けています。また、最終章では、XML DBだけでなく様々なXMLに関連する製品、技術、ツールを紹介しています。

◆ Contents ◆

chapter1 XMLデータベースを理解するための基礎知識
1.1 はじめに
1.2 HTMLとXML
1.3 XMLドキュメントの概要
1.4 データフォーマット
1.5 データベースの基本機能
1.5.1 複数ユーザーからのアクセスへの対応
1.5.2 最小の処理単位(トランザクション)
1.5.3 アプリケーションとの独立
1.5.4 冗長的なデータとその整合性
1.5.5 データベースのアーキテクチャ
1.6 メタデータとは
chapter2 XML関連の仕様
2.1 DTD
2.2 XML Schema
2.3 XPath
2.4 XQuery
2.5 XQuery Update Facility
2.5.1 XQueryでの更新処理
chapter3 RDBとXML DB
3.1 はじめに
3.2 データの種類
3.3 データ構造
3.4 スキーマ
3.5 対応アプリケーション
3.6 クエリー言語
3.7 データの順序性
3.8 データアクセスのためのAPI
3.9 プロトコル
3.10 参照整合性
3.11 インデックス
chapter4 XMLドキュメントの格納
4.1 リレーショナルデータベースへ要素ごとに分解して格納する
4.1.1 リレーショナルテーブルからXMLを
4.1.2 XMLをリレーショナルテーブルに
4.2 検索エンジンにタグ情報とともに要素ごとに格納する
4.2.1 検索エンジンとメタデータ
4.3 CLOBあるいはBLOBのようなテキストあるいはバイナリデータとして一括して格納する
4.4 リレーショナルデータベースによって提供されるXMLデータ型を使用する
4.4.1 XMLデータ型の使用方法
4.4.2 XMLデータ型へのスキーマの適用
4.4.3 XQueryのサポート
4.5 ネイティブXMLデータベースを使用する
4.5.1 データベースの作成・管理
4.5.2 データベースの操作
4.5.3 XMLの格納
4.5.4 データの検索
4.5.5 XMLのノードの追加
chapter5 XMLアプリケーション分野
5.1 SOA
5.2 エンタープライズサーチ
5.3 コンテンツ管理
5.3.1 エンタープライズコンテンツ管理
5.3.2 Webコンテンツ管理
5.4 データ統合
5.5 ビジネスプロセス
5.6 XML EDIの普及
chapter6 実践!XML DB
6.1 Xpriori(NeoCoreXMS)のインストールと管理コンソール
6.1.1 Xprioriのインストール
6.1.2 Xprioriの起動と停止
6.1.3 NeoCore XMS(管理コンソール)
6.2 不動産情報XMLデータベース
6.2.1 不動産情報の概観
6.3 不動産情報データベースの構築
6.3.1 不動産情報のまとめ
6.3.2 不動産情報データベースを作る
6.3.3 不動産情報を問合わせる
6.3.4 不動産情報を更新する
6.3.5 不動産情報を削除する
6.3.6 不動産情報を追加する
6.3.7 不動産情報を利用する
6.4 不動産情報データベースシステム
chapter7 世の中のXML関連プロダクト
7.1 XML関連ツール、データベースの紹介
7.1.1 リレーショナル XQuery
7.1.2 XMLSpy 2006
7.1.3 Sherlock
7.1.4 BizQuery
7.1.5 Qizx/open
7.1.6 AquaLogic Data Services Platform
7.1.7 Nux
7.1.8 XStreamDB
7.1.9 XQ2XML
7.1.10 Cerebra Server
7.1.11 XQuantum
7.1.12 DataDirect XQuery
7.1.13 Stylus Studio 5.0
7.1.14 eXist
7.1.15 XQEngine
7.1.16 Derby
7.1.17 Galax (GalaTex)
7.1.18 Qexo
7.1.19 Ipedo XIP
7.1.20 xqnsta
7.1.21 DB2 Content Manager
7.1.22 IPSI-XQ
7.1.23 Sedna XML Database
7.1.24 MarkLogic Server
7.1.25 Microsoft SQL Server 2005 Express Edition
7.1.26 MonetDB
7.1.27 Mono
7.1.28 Virtuoso
7.1.29 Oracle XQuery
7.1.30 PHP XML Class
7.1.31 XQBE
7.1.32 SQL/XML-IMDB
7.1.33 TigerLogic XDMS XML Data Management Server
7.1.34 FluXQuery
7.1.35 Saxon
7.1.36 Berkeley DB XML
7.1.37 Tamino XML Server
7.1.38 Sonic XML Server
7.1.39 XQP
7.1.40 Rainbow
7.1.41 Blixem LiXQuery Engine
7.1.42 X-Hive/DB (XQuery Demo)
7.1.43 NeoCore
7.1.44 XQuare
7.1.45 Xyleme
7.1.46 TOTAL XML
7.1.47 DOMSafeXML
7.1.48 Tera Text Database System
7.1.49 TEXTML Server
7.1.50 OpenInsight
7.1.51 Sybase Adaptive Server Enterprise
7.2 XMLデータベースのプロダクトマトリックス
7.2.1 プロダクトカテゴリ
7.2.2 ミドルウエア
7.2.3 開発環境、エディタ
7.2.4 XMLデータベース
7.2.5 ネイティブXMLデータベース
7.2.6 XMLサーバ
7.2.7 ラッパー
7.2.8 コンテンツマネジメントシステム
7.2.9 Discontinuedプロダクトリ

▲このページのTOPへ

  • XMLとは?IT初心者でもすぐわかるXML超入門
  • 無償で使える!XMLDB「NeoCore」
  • サイバーテック求人情報
  • メールマガジン申し込み
  • TEchScore

  • ▲NeoCoreについて記載されています!

  • ▲XMLマスター教則本です。試験対策はこれでばっちり!
Copyright (c) CyberTech corporation ltd. All ights Reserved. | サイバーテックについて | ご利用ガイド